Seniors in a nursing home would appreciate Medford, New York, for its blend of community resources and peaceful environment. The nearby Medford Library offers various programs tailored for older adults, such as book clubs and technology classes that foster engagement. Additionally, the Medford Parks and Recreation Department frequently organizes wellness activities and social events specifically designed for seniors, promoting an active lifestyle. Proximity to the Long Island Rail Road also provides convenient access to nearby cultural attractions, enhancing residents' opportunities for outings and socialization.

Considerations for seniors living in Medford, NY
Excellent Medical Facilities: Medford has a vast range of medical facilities and hospitals, including the Brookhaven Memorial Hospital Medical Center, which is equipped with state-of-the-art technology to cater to all medical needs.
Active Community: There are numerous senior centers and community organizations in Medford that offer programs and activities for seniors to stay active and engaged.
Accessible Transportation: Seniors can easily access public transportation options like trains and buses to travel around Long Island or visit neighboring towns such as Patchogue or Bayshore.
Pleasant Climate: Medford has a comfortable climate that is neither too hot nor too cold, making it ideal for seniors.
Affordable Housing: Compared to other areas near New York City, Medford offers affordable housing options for seniors on a fixed income.
Recreational Opportunities: Medford's scenic parks, lakes, golf courses provide an excellent opportunity for outdoor activities that seniors can enjoy at their own pace.
Easy Access to Shopping and Dining Venues: The area boasts several shopping centers with supermarkets, drug stores, restaurants/cafes and specialty shops that cater to the needs of residents of all ages including seniors.
